The Parcelwick webhook delivers tracking events as JSON POST requests to your registered endpoint, retrying failed deliveries up to five times with exponential backoff. Plugins must acknowledge within ten seconds or the event is requeued. Event payloads include status, checkpoint, and carrier fields. To verify deliveries and fetch missed events, your plugin authenticates to the internal replay service using the key below.

service key, fawip-bajef: kto11_Qt5wZK9vdNC

/*
 * PARTITION_GRANULARITY: monthly. The Ledgerpine events table is split
 * by calendar month; the rollover job creates next month's partition
 * on the 25th. If inserts fail near month-end, check that the new
 * partition exists before paging storage. Verify you are on the
 * migration build recorded below.
 */

pipeline stamp: htk9_6ce9d33c5

## Authentication

Restocker (the Fizzlane vending restock planner) talks to the internal routes service for depot assignments. All calls require a service key in the request header; unauthenticated calls return 403. Keys rotate monthly — stale keys are the usual cause of empty route plans. For this sprint, use the following key.

API key for tagef-fafop: vxb2-ta

**Action Item PM-14:** During the Quillgate incident, the public REST API's cursor pagination silently reset to page one when a cursor expired mid-traversal, causing downstream consumers to double-count records. Owner: on-call rotation. Within two weeks, add explicit 410 responses for expired cursors, document cursor TTLs in the reference, and add a canary that walks a 10k-record collection nightly. Full remediation checklist and progress tracker are maintained on the internal page below.

dashboard of yaguf-hahig = https://grafana.urlaqworks.test/secrets